Shingle repair services involve the inspection, replacement, and restoration of damaged or missing shingles on a roof. This process typically includes identifying areas where shingles have become cracked, curled, or displaced due to weather, age, or other factors. Local contractors may remove and replace individual shingles or sections of the roof to ensure the structure remains weather-resistant and maintains its appearance. Proper repair helps prevent further damage, such as leaks or structural issues, by addressing issues before they escalate.
These services are essential for resolving common roofing problems like leaks, water intrusion, and shingle deterioration. Damaged shingles can allow moisture to penetrate the roof system, leading to water stains, mold growth, and potential rot within the underlying roof deck. Timely repairs can help mitigate these issues, extending the lifespan of the roof and maintaining the property's overall integrity. Contractors often use specialized tools and materials to ensure that repairs blend seamlessly with the existing roofing system.

Average Cost Range - Shingle repair services typically cost between $300 and $1,200 depending on the extent of damage. For minor repairs, costs may be closer to $300, while extensive work can reach higher amounts.
Factors Influencing Costs - The cost of shingle repairs varies based on the number of shingles involved, the type of shingles, and the complexity of the roof. Repairs on steep or complex roofs tend to be more expensive.
Material and Labor Costs - Expenses include both materials, which can range from $50 to $150 per bundle of shingles, and labor, which may add $200 to $800 to the overall cost depending on the project size.
Cost Variability - Prices for shingle repair services vary across local providers and geographic areas, with typical costs fluctuating based on the severity of damage and specific service requ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my shingles need repair? Signs like missing, cracked, or curling shingles, as well as leaks or water stains on ceilings, can indicate the need for repair. Consulting a local roofing professional can help assess the condition of your shingles.
What causes shingles to become damaged? Common causes include severe weather conditions, aging, improper installation, and physical impacts such as falling debris.
How long does shingle rep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
Are shingle repairs covered by warranty? Warranty coverage depends on the manufacturer and the contractor; it's advisable to inquire with local pros about warranty options for repairs.
